From the documentation the usage is given:

makeself.sh [args] archive_dir file_name label startup_script [script_args]

When aiming to provide the password programmatically via something like --ssl-pass-src env:password

  • The --ssl-pass-src option is accepted by makeself among the [args]
  • The --ssl-pass-src option is accepted by the self extracting archive as a directly supplied option.
  • BUT it cannot be offered as a default option indicated by usage above in [script_args]
